So first up is probably the announcement many had been hoping for in recent years with the sudden surge in remastered titles, and that is the remastering of the iconic second title in the series, Sniper Elite V2 Remastered. Of course, it would have been lovely to have seen the series’ first title make a remastered appearance too, but with Sniper Elite V2 being one of the best games in the series, there’s no denying many will be excited by the chance to head back to Berlin. Sniper Elite V2 is a game that has seen huge success, with it even having a bunch of successful mods that eventually spurned the development of Zombie Army Trilogy – but what’s new this time around?
Whilst some may well be questioning the decision to remaster Sniper Elite V2 given the already present backwards compatibility of the Xbox 360 title, this remastered return will see players able to jump on in with some great new features. First of all will be the stunningly enhanced graphics, complete with 4K resolution and HDR compatibility. That’s a big deal for those sporting either an Xbox One S, or an Xbox One X, as that means even crisper visuals, clearer pictures and much nicer textures. If that’s not enough though Sniper Elite V2 Remastered will also see the arrival of new playable characters this time around, as well as an all new photo mode for the screenshot enthusiasts amongst us, and even an expanded online multiplayer with up to 16 players now able to take to the battlefield in some online World War 2 warfare. What’s more is that it will be available later this year on Xbox One, PlayStation 4, PC and Nintendo Switch.
Now whilst Sniper Elite V2 Remastered is fantastic news, there’s very little more exciting than hearing of the existence of the next step in the series. Sniper Elite 5. At present there is little to go on besides the fact Rebellion have today confirmed they are working on the next game in the series, but a confirmation we’ll see even more sniping perfection is of course something we need to be shouting from the rooftops.
If that doesn’t fill your boots and you find yourself also enjoying some gaming on the go, then maybe the announcement of Sniper Elite 3 Ultimate Edition for Nintendo Switch will be what you find yourself looking for, as later in 2019 players will be able to take to the soaring temperatures of North Africa on the go.
And finally, comes the news of a new standalone adventure for Sniper Elite with a VR game confirmed to be in development, with highly respected British studio Just Add Water aiding in the development of the upcoming mainline title that is set to arrive at some point in 2020.
